Internet Merchant Accounts
Internet merchants are not just those who have ecommerce websites. They can also be those who turn their personal computers into “virtual terminals” and process credit cards over a secure server. These merchants receive keyed rates because the credit card information is 100% keyed into the computer. Keyed rates are higher than swiped rates because more risks are involved in not being able to check the ID of a customer. To decrease risk, the secure server (gateway) portal requires specific information to help identify if the customer is really the cardholder. The billing address for the credit card is requested (AVS), as is the expiration date of the card, and the 3 to 4 digit code on the front or back of the credit card (CVV2 number). Transactions where this data matches the card will receive a lower discount keyed rate than when the data does not match the card, as those transactions are more risky and possibly fraudulent.
You will have to pay an additional fee as an Internet merchant account holder. This additional fee is the Secure Gateway Fee. Both ecommerce and virtual credit card merchant account holders have this additional fee, as the cardholder’s information will be passing over the Internet for processing in each case. The gateway keeps cardholder data private and secure from hackers and identity thieves. RockBottom Merchant Accounts uses Authorize.net as its gateway provider. Authorize.net is a PCI DDS (Payment Card Industry Data Security Standard) compliant company, so you know you are getting the best with this merchant account service.

Retail Merchant Accounts
Retail merchants process face-to-face sales through the credit card terminal by swiping the card. This allows you to obtain lower discount rates on your transactions and mitigate risk by checking the customer’s picture ID to verify that the credit card belongs to the customer. Retail merchants are both storefront locations as well as in businesses where the merchants travel with a wireless credit card terminal. In both cases, at least 50% of your payment processing activity should involve face-to-face swiped transactions. Retail merchants also have the ability to process checks, gift cards and process PIN-based debit transactions by having the customers key in PIN-numbers.
